Engine and Transmission
The Honda Z50R is a 4 stroke, Pocket Bike bike with a Air cooled 50.00 ccm (3,03 cubic inches) Single cylinder, 2 Valve type of engine. This engine then gets the power to the rear wheel with a Chain driven transmission.
